Easy Fudgy 3-Ingredient Nutella Brownies

A quick and simple recipe for rich, fudgy brownies made with just Nutella, eggs, and flour. Perfect for beginners and those craving a fast chocolate fix.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up (280g) Nutella
  • 2 large eggs, room temperature
  • 1/2 cup (65g) all-purpose flour
  • Optional: pinch of salt
  • Optional: 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Optional: chopped nuts or chocolate chips

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Prepare an 8×8-inch baking pan by greasing it lightly or lining it with parchment paper.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ine 1 cup (280g) Nutella with 2 large room temperature eggs. Whisk until smooth and glossy, about 2-3 minutes.
  3. Gradually sift or sprinkle in 1/2 cup (65g) all-purpose flour. Fold gently until no streaks remain, being careful not to overmix.
  4. If desired, fold in a pinch of salt, 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ract, or a handful of chopped nuts or chocolate chips.
  5. Pour the batter evenly into the prepared pan and smooth the surface with a spatula.
  6. Bake for 20-22 minutes. Check doneness by inserting a toothpick in the center; it should come out with moist crumbs but not wet batter.
  7. Allow the brownies to cool completely in the pan on a wire rack before cutting.
  8. Cut into 9 or 12 squares depending on preferred size and serve.

Notes

Do not overbake to keep brownies fudgy. Use room temperature eggs for better mixing. Warming Nutella slightly can help if it’s too thick. Lining the pan with parchment paper makes cleanup easier and prevents sticking. For a gluten-free version, substitute flour with almond flour or gluten-free blend. Optional add-ins like nuts or chocolate chips add texture and flavor.
